Current schedule data connects Picton (PCN) with 1 connected airport in 1 country. The route list can change as airlines publish new seasons, so the page is rebuilt from the latest available schedule aggregate.
The current route data includes 1 airline: Sounds Air. Use the airline filter to isolate any one of them on the map.
The longest nonstop connection currently present in the route data is Wellington (WLG), about 44 miles from Picton. It is offered by Sounds Air.
